What Is A Hoverboard?

A hoverboard, or more accurately, a self-balancing scooter or balance board, is basically a “Segway” without handlebars.

Does it really hover off the ground?

Sadly, no – we aren’t living the experience depicted in the Back to the Future movies (yet).

Then what makes a hoverboard so fascinating?

These marvellous devices seem to amaze anyone who rides them or who watches someone ride one, especially older people.

Hoverboards allow you to move around by simply leaning in the direction you want to travel.

The board stays balanced thanks to sensors that also control direction and speed.

The Wheel Sensors

Hoverboards have two wheels that house the electric motors themselves, as well as the tilt and speed sensors.

These sensors detect the RPM (revolutions per minute) of each wheel in order to make you speed up or slow down depending on how far you lean towards one direction.

You’re probably thinking, “Well this sounds dangerous..”.

Not to worry. The speed sensors are connected to the motherboard which continually measures the hoverboard’s speed to prevent you from going over the safe speed limit.

A beeping sound is the warning to tell you to slow down.

The Logic Board (Motherboard)

Think of this as the brain of the hoverboard – the part that runs the show.

It controls the speed at which you travel. It runs the built-in program that controls the movement of the wheels based on the direction you are leaning. Therefore allowing you to make accurate movements.

The logic board also controls the board’s power management.

For example, if you are in ‘beginner mode’ it limits the maximum speed of the board.

Gyroscopes

Gyroscopes are sensors used to measure the orientation and angular velocity of the hoverboard. They play a crucial role in maintaining your balance while riding.

They do this by measuring the rotational position of the hoverboard (according to how far you’re leaning).

Now, this is where it gets technical. Your tilt and speed data is then sent to the logic board – which sends a current to the electromagnetic motors. And a magnetic force is applied in opposite directions to keep everything in perfect balance.

The gyroscopes are located on each side of the board, near the wheels.

The Battery Pack

Needless to say, the batteries give your board the power to keep going.

It’s super important to make sure the lithium-ion batteries that come with your hoverboard are as safe as possible.

The reason for this is that some manufacturers and brands are selling cheaper hoverboards with smaller capacity batteries.

These batteries can be really dangerous and they’ve unfortunately caused the ‘Hoverboard Injuries’ headlines you might’ve seen on the news.

Non-UL-certified batteries have been reported to catch on fire while the board is being ridden, or while it’s charging.

By buying your hoverboard from a trusted, reputable brand you can rest assured that the batteries will be safe.

While it might be tempting to purchase a board for half the price – it’s not worth the risk. Always check that the batteries are certified to be safe.
